Gonzalez Sr. Note we would not use the abbreviation Esq. when another title is given … In the English language, an honorific is a form of address conveying esteem, courtesy or respect. These can be titles prefixing a person's name, e.g.: Mr, Mrs, Miss, Ms, Mx, Sir, Dame, Dr, Cllr, Lady or Lord, or titles or positions that can appear as a form of address without the person's name, as in Mr President, General, Captain, Father, Doctor or Earl.

WebKey Difference: Surname is the family name that that one shares with other family members. This name is passed from one generation to the other. On the other hand, title is additional term that is also used to address a person and is generally added either before a name or after the name.
